A Complete Document Formatting Solution for Your Enterprise Applications
FormPort Flash is a printer-based document formatting solution that gives users the ability to automatically convert raw, ASCII data streams into professional, graphics-rich forms. Similar in appearance to a standard printer memory module, the FormPort Flash can be installed into any available memory expansion socket in a compatible, Chai-server equipped, HP® LaserJet® black and white or color laser printer.
The FormPort Flash includes either 4MB or 8MB of storage and an integrated software application. The memory is used to store preformatted document templates. These templates position the ASCII text fi elds output by enterprise applications and format it in a variety of fonts and sizes. Templates can also include photos, logos and other graphics, providing a completely customizable document formatting solution. For organizations that rely upon numerous forms with substantial graphics, FormPort Flash can also utilize the printer's internal hard drive, if one is available.
Automatic Formatting Capabilities
To take advantage of the formatting features of the FormPort Flash, network users can simply direct their application to print to the FormPort Flash equipped printer. It's that simple!
The FormPort Flash will then scan the incoming ASCII data stream. After examining the data in one or more pre-determined fields, the FormPort Flash will automatically select the correct form template and launch the print job. No user intervention or special commands are required. Print jobs from applications that do not require the capabilities of the FormPort Flash will simply output as usual.
Automatic Creation of Multiple Forms
Quite often, an organization will need to create two or more different types of forms from the same data at the same time. For instance, a shipping department might need to print both an invoice and a packing list. In the medical profession, it's not unusual to have several documents that rely upon the same data.
The FormPort Flash can be used to simplify the production of multiple forms, whether they are duplications of the same form or different, visually unique forms based upon the same data. The FormPort Flash can even select or exclude data fields, varying both the content and the appearance of the form based upon the intended recipient.
Best of all, the whole process is automatic. Specific types of data can be used to trigger the creation of multiple forms. When the FormPort Flash sees this data, it will automatically generate the different documents with no user intervention required.
Easy-to-Implement
The FormPort Flash's Confi gurator module gives network administrators to the ability to control the conditions under which a form or job is launched. Using the printer's internal web page and a sample ASCII data stream from the enterprise application, an administrator can indicate the line number, column and character string that will trigger each type of job.
Using Capella's optional FormPort Designer software, designing form templates for the FormPort Flash is similarly straightforward. This PC-based, windows application provides a simple, WYSIWIG interface, giving users the ability to add text, lines, logos and even photos to form templates. It supports multiple fonts, including MICR fonts and bar-coding. For users that do not have the resources necessary to produce their own forms template, Capella provides a form creation service.

Compatibility
The FormPort Flash is ideal for organizations with multiple hardware platforms. Since it resides in the printer and is dependent solely upon ASCII data streams, it can accept output from practically any hardware source on the network - including AS400 systems, mainframes and PCs - regardless of the operating system.
